The anatomy of your Moen faucet.
Your Moen faucet is equipped with one 
of Moen’s durable cartridges, which are 
unequalled in quality and reliability. Though 
a well-made faucet should last for years, 
you may occasionally need to make some 
simple faucet adjustments. Leaky faucets 
or hard-to-move handles or knobs are easy 
to fix by simply changing the cartridge. Moen 
Genuine Parts may be available at home 
centers and plumbing suppliers. In addition, 
you can call 1-800-BUY-MOEN or go to 
moen.com/replacement-parts.
Before replacing the cartridge:
Since faucet cartridges come in several styles,  
it is best to take your old cartridge along when 
shopping for a replacement. Moen recommends using a genuine Moen 
replacement cartridge so that you will not void the faucet warranty.
Before starting the job, make sure you have 
 the correct tools: 
• Pliers • Phillips and regular screwdrivers 
• Adjustable or basin wrench • Utility knife 
• Hex key / Allen wrench
